2021 UAA Annual Accreditation/Assessment Seminar
Preparing for the Mid-Cycle Visit
Friday, Sept. 17, 2021 via Zoom
9–11 a.m.

This year’s annual seminar will focus on preparing for the Oct. 7-8 NWCCU Mid-Cycle Evaluation site visit. Chancellor Parnell and Provost Runge will kick off the session with a welcome and, along with the accreditation tri-chairs and the Accreditation Advisory Committee, will guide us through reflections about UAA’s Mid-Cycle Evaluation.

To prepare, think of examples and stories that demonstrate how your program or unit 1) integrates or plans to integrate the core competencies into your work; 2) closes the loop on assessment and uses the results to improve student learning and achievement; 3) uses or plans to use the disaggregated student achievement data in your decision-making and resource-allocation processes in order to close equity gaps.
